Why they're listed

Kickboxer turned manosphere mega-influencer. His Hustlers University (relaunched as The Real World) sells monthly 'wealth creation' mentorship; a 2022 Observer investigation found its affiliate program paid members commission to mass-repost Tate's most controversial clips — internal guidance told members to engineer '60-70% fans and 40-30% haters… you want arguments, you want war' — and to recruit new paying members, a structure critics compared to a pyramid scheme. The affiliate program shut down days after the exposé, as Meta and TikTok deplatformed him. Blockchain analysts at Elliptic traced over $2.5 million in crypto payments into the operation. He separately faces criminal proceedings in Romania, unrelated to the courses, which he denies. Listed here for the course-plus-recruitment machine and the engineered-outrage marketing engine behind it — not the tabloid noise.

The Hustlers University affiliate machine: recruit, repost, engineer outrage

The Observer's August 2022 investigation described Hustlers University's affiliate program: 100,000+ members earning commission for recruiting new subscribers and instructed to flood social media with Tate's most divisive clips ('you want arguments, you want war'). The program closed days later, after Meta and TikTok bans, as The Guardian reported. BuzzFeed News documented the relaunch as 'Hustlers University 2.0' with ~200,000 subscribers; Elliptic's on-chain analysis traced $2.5M+ in crypto into the operation.
